One of the most anticipated events in sports, FIFA World Cup 26™ will be hosted across North America with games in the US, Mexico, and Canada. Seattle is excited to host six matches from June 15-July 6.
Visitors traveling though Seattle by car may encounter increased traffic during Interstate-5 upgrades.
More information is available via WSDOT’s Revive I-5 webpage.
